Summary Pakistan hockey team will leave for Beijing today for a 1st Asian Champions Trophy.

The squad, led by Muhammad Amir, comprises Shakeel Abbassi, Imran Shah, Ali Shan, Imran Butt, Rizwan Junior, Muhammad Waseem Ahmed, Rashid Mehmood, Fareed Ahmed, Muhammad Tauseeq, Waqas Sharif, Umar Bhatta, Kashif Shah, Muhammad Irfan Junior, Abdul Haseem and Kashif Javed.The championship will be played from Sept 3 to Sept 11. Before the start of the event, the green shirts will play a friendly each against Japan and China.Pakistan will play their opening match against Malaysia on Sept 3 and second match against S Korea the next day. Pakistan will take on arch rival India on Sept 9.
